The Medical Lead is responsible for the Medical Affairs Tactics in line with the overall strategy for the Therapeutic Area as well as the Medical Engagement plans. Further, the Medical Lead is the subject matter expert (SME) within specified therapy area having in-depth scientific knowledge and scientific leadership when collaborating with cross-functional colleagues and leading cross-functional team(s) throughout the product life cycle.
Key responsibilities:
Acts as the SME for relevant TA(s)
•Has an in-depth knowledge and understanding of the unmet medical need, SoC (standard of care), competitive landscape and external stakeholder views within TA as well as collaborates and co-develops Country value proposition (including reimbursement dossiers) with Market Access.
•Develops and executes the Medical Affairs Tactics for the Therapy Area aligned with the overall TA strategy.
•Ensures that all Adverse Events (AEs) are brought to attention to the Patient Safety department and Product Complaints to Quality organization within 24 hours after received, as well as provides scientific and medical input as well as guidance and review for post-launch marketing materials and concept generation for prioritized brand.
Therapy Area accountabilities
•Adapts and executes initiatives for life cycle management plans of the Therapeutic area(s) as well as understands Therapy area (TA) and collects insights. Discusses data in relation to TA externally and is mainly external and customer facing in engaging HCPs as well as having a patient centric mindset according to TA strategy.
•Responsible for compliance to global/regional medical excellence guidelines, including applicable SOPs, regulations and performance indicators (metrics).
•Plans and implements advice seeking plans and activities including running advisory boards and the systematic collection of field medical intelligence (FM-IQ) and together with cross-functional team propose actions based on FM-IQ.
Medical Expert (ME) Engagement and development:
•Plans and implements the aligned ME engagement strategy for the relevant TA(s) as well as maps all prioritized MEs within TA(s) and builds strong and sustainable relationships with key healthcare providers and medical societies.
•Responsible for medical segmentation process based on cross-functional input from all relevant stakeholders, and governs and follows up the ME engagement activities for the Therapeutic area(s)
Data Generation and dissemination:
•Plans and deploys the Data Gap Assessment process in the Therapeutic area(s), as well as the alignment with Nordic, Regional and Global data gaps and integrated evidence plans.
• Develops and implements Country data generation plans based on Country data gap analysis as well as provides up to date and in-depth medical and clinical knowledge to external and internal stakeholders.
•Has oversight of registries with the potential to generate relevant data supporting the Health Technology Assessment (HTA) and other activities throughout the life cycle.
Patient, digital and other initiatives:
•Knows, plans, effectively uses and contributes to development of digital channels and digital solutions to engage with stakeholders and influencers.
• Sets up and deploys digital initiatives for the TA(s) together with other colleagues as well as maps relevant patient associations and if relevant collaborates with them to identify gaps in treatment of patients.
